YMCA sports

The Northwest YMCA will host indoor soccer for kids this fall.

The fall indoor soccer league season is open to boys and girls ages 3-7. The season runs Nov. 7-Dec. 19, and the registration deadline is Oct. 30. Games are played on Saturdays from 9-11 a.m.

YMCA leagues stress basic skills, and no scores or standings are kept. A $25 YMCA membership is required for participation in the programs. For more information, call Matt Klock at 257-7160, ext. 19.

The YMCA is also looking for paid officials for the upcoming winter basketball league season. No experience is necessary, and training is available through the YMCA. Games are played Saturdays,
9 a.m.-4 p.m., from Jan. 9 through March 14. Officials must commit to the entire season, and officials are paid $6-7 per hour, based on experience. Call 257-7160, ext. 19, for information.

Baseball camps

A series of Stanford holiday baseball camps will be offered in November and December.

Hitting and defensive instruction will be offered over Thanksgiving weekend, Nov. 27-29, and there will be pitching, hitting and defensive camps over Christmas vacation on Dec. 20-22 and Dec. 27-29.

The camps are open to players ages 13-18, and the cost is $100 per sessions.

For more information, call Stanford assistant baseball coach Mark O'Brien at 1-650-723-4528.
